Common Causes

Common Sources of Water Loss Across Bridgeport

After years of Bridgeport calls, these sources come up again and again.

Burst or Frozen Pipes

Aging plumbing and sudden cold snaps are among the top reasons Bridgeport residents call us — a single burst pipe can release hundreds of gallons before it's noticed, often overnight while everyone's asleep.

Severe Weather Damage

Heavy storms and aging roofing materials contribute to water intrusion in Bridgeport properties, especially in older roof systems nearing the end of their lifespan and due for replacement.

Sump Pump Failure

Clogged lines and sump pump failures can send contaminated water into Bridgeport basements during heavy rain, requiring specialized cleanup and sanitizing before repairs begin.

Slow Hidden Leaks

A failing water heater can leak for weeks, often causing more structural damage than a sudden burst would have caused.

Foundation Moisture

Improper grading around a Bridgeport property's foundation directs rainwater toward the structure instead of away, causing chronic basement moisture over time.

Mechanical System Leaks

HVAC condensation lines and mechanical equipment can leak slowly for weeks in Bridgeport properties, often going unnoticed until a ceiling stain or musty smell appears.

Why Call a Pro

The Hidden Risk of Handling Water Damage Yourself

A shop vac and a couple of fans can make a Bridgeport property look dry on the surface — but "looks dry" and "is actually dry" are two different things.

What makes DIY cleanup risky isn't the initial mop-up — it's everything you can't see afterward. Household fans move air across a surface, but they don't pull moisture out of building materials the way commercial dehumidifiers do, and that gap is where Bridgeport homeowners end up with mold problems months later.

Insurance carriers generally want documented proof a loss was properly mitigated. A DIY cleanup rarely produces that record, which can leave Bridgeport homeowners exposed if related damage surfaces months down the road.

Our Equipment

Why Our Drying Equipment Beats a Box Fan

Our Bridgeport trucks carry truck-mounted extraction units, low-grain-refrigerant dehumidifiers, high-velocity air movers, and moisture meters that read behind walls without cutting into them.

A rental-store fan moves air across a surface. Our dehumidification setup actively pulls moisture out of building materials, cutting drying time from weeks down to days on most Bridgeport jobs.
